Japanese Sacrifice
Originally released in 1910. Japanese Sacrifice is a drama film. directed by Adolf Gärtner. At just 10 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Lupu Pick, Frederic Zelnik, and Albert Steinrück
Synopsis
A friend sacrifices himself, taking the blame for a murder upon himself. A guilty conscience will end up killing the real culprit.
